Download Solution PDFWhat is the maximum number of electrons that can be filled in the K shell of an atom?

Download Solution PDFThe correct answer is 2.
Key Points
- The maximum number of electrons that can be filled in the K shell of an atom is 2.
- Each subshell is constrained to hold 4ℓ + 2 electrons at most, namely:
- Each s subshell holds at most 2 electrons
- Each p subshell holds at most 6 electrons
- Each d subshell holds at most 10 electrons
- Each f subshell holds at most 14 electrons
- Each g subshell holds at most 18 electrons
- Therefore, the K shell, which contains only an s subshell, can hold up to 2 electrons.
- The L shell, which contains an s and a p, can hold up to 2 + 6 = 8 electrons, and so forth; in general, the nth shell can hold up to 2n2 electrons.
